On Thursday, May 22, Breaking Benjamin guitarist Keith Wallen made an appearance on Loudwire Nights. You can enjoy the complete conversation in the audio player located near the end of this article.

During the interview, Wallen delved into his latest solo track, “Us Against the World,” and also revealed exciting updates about the forthcoming music from Breaking Benjamin.
“We communicate in a cryptic way, filled with smoke and mirrors,” Wallen humorously remarked to host Chuck Armstrong regarding the band’s anticipated full-length album. This playful comment reflects the band’s creative process and their desire to keep fans intrigued.
“The truth is — we have taken considerable time to craft this music because we genuinely want it to be exceptional. Our love for our fans drives us to ensure they cherish what we produce, and we have no desire to deliver anything less than our best,” he emphasized sincerely.
Wallen acknowledged the patience exhibited by fans throughout this waiting period and confidently assured them that they will not be disappointed when new music from Breaking Benjamin is finally unveiled, especially following the success of last year’s single, “Awaken.”
“Yes, it’s taking longer than expected, but sometimes you have to be patient for quality material,” he stated firmly.
“‘Awaken’ surpassed our expectations. We were deeply thankful and genuinely thrilled by the overwhelming response to our first new track,” he expressed with sincerity.
As he discussed this, Wallen felt compelled to address a misconception he often sees circulating among fans online.

“I want to clarify that my solo projects do not interfere with the creative process of Breaking Benjamin,” he stated matter-of-factly.
“Sometimes I’ll release a solo track and people comment, ‘You’re wasting time on this; we want Breaking Ben!’ which I find quite rude… but I understand their sentiment. However, it has no bearing on our band’s efforts.”
Key Insights from Keith Wallen’s Discussion on Loudwire Nights
- Importance of “Us Against the World”: “I’ve held onto this song for a while. It didn’t quite fit the Infinity Now album, but it’s something I truly cherish. I’m incredibly proud of it. I actually wrote it during the COVID-19 pandemic when we were all stuck at home, grappling with the state of the world. It inspired me to create something meaningful.”
- Challenges of Releasing Solo Music: “I find that I need to continuously release music to stay relevant and maintain visibility in a saturated market. With countless new releases happening every second, it’s easy for artists to be forgotten. I must remind everyone, ‘Hey, I’m still here. Here’s a new song for you to enjoy.’
- Motivation Behind Solo and Band Projects: “I recognize that there will come a time when I can no longer perform music, play guitar, or sing. Right now, I possess the capability to do all of these things adequately, so I’m seizing the moment to create while I still can.”
